The 2024 Music Victoria Awards return to The Edge at Federation Square on Thursday, 24 October, and the event will be livestreamed via the Music Victoria website. In exciting news, entries are now open for submission to the 2024 Music Victoria Awards.

Artists, venues, and festivals can submit themselves for consideration for this year’s awards from today until Friday, 19 July. You can go here to find out how to submit your entry and check out all the award nomination categories below.

In addition to awards celebrating the best music made by Victorian artists in different genres throughout the year, as well as venue, festival, and community awards, the Music Victoria Awards will once again induct creatives into the Hall of Fame.

It’s not just musicians who can be inducted, with the category wide open for broadcasters, producers, journalists, music managers, record labels, and more. As long as you’ve been in the Victorian music industry for over 25 years and contributed significantly to its music scene, you will likely be eligible for a nomination.

Nominations for the 2024 Music Victoria Hall of Fame are now open – you can find more information here.

Previous Hall of Fame inductees include Archie RoachKylie MinogueOlivia Newton-John, Michael GudinskiHelen Marcou AM, and Ian Quincy McLean AM. Last year, Kutcha Edwards and Kirsty Rivers were welcomed as honourable inductees into the Music Victoria Hall of Fame.

Music Victoria’s CEO Simone Schinkel said of this year’s awards in a statement: “Music Victoria acknowledges the rich contributions made by individuals from a variety of backgrounds to the Victorian contemporary music scene.

“The Music Victoria Awards aim to honour this diversity and strongly encourage entries from First Peoples, those from culturally and linguistically diverse backgrounds, Deaf and Disabled individuals, and members of the LGBTIQA+ community.

“2024 will be the second year in which entrants do not need to be Music Victoria members, meaning everyone in the Victorian music industry can put themselves and the artists and venues they represent in consideration for nomination.

“As the landscape around us evolves, it’s a vital time to celebrate those changing our scene for the better as they pivot and reimagine their work.”
